## Service Accounts: Export Retry Flow

The Osperling export pipeline uses the svc-retry account to reprocess failed ledger exports from the Tallowick warehouse. Retries are capped at five attempts, after which the job is parked for manual review. The service account holds read access to the export queue and write access to the retry log only; no other scopes are granted. For audit reproduction, reviewers may call the retry endpoint directly using the key below.

API key for fahif-bahop: vxb23-B1zKyQaAnaG4Gma9WuizPfB

Ticket OPS-883: Expired credential breaks logtail CLI

The internal `snipe` CLI used for tailing logs from the Corvid aggregation service started returning 401s this morning. Root cause: the service credential baked into the CLI's default profile expired on schedule, but the release that reads it from the keystore never shipped. Short-term fix: issue a fresh credential and cut a patch release. Reviewer, please check the keystore fallback in auth.go before approving. The replacement key for Corvid is below.

API key for tagef-fafop: vxb2-ta

**Step 4 — Crossword key handoff**

Welcome aboard! Before you can publish grids from the Puzzlewick generator, you'll take custody of the signing key during today's little ceremony. Just confirm the clue database snapshot matches the manifest, sign the witness sheet, and you're set. To unlock the key escrow afterwards, use the recovery passphrase written just below.

strongbox words: oliael-aldax

**Q: How do soft deletes work in the Bramblewick orders table?**

When an order is "deleted," we never remove the row. Instead, the `deleted_at` column is set and all standard queries filter it out via the default scope. This preserves audit history and lets support restore orders within 90 days. Restoring requires elevated access through the Larkspur recovery console. To authenticate the restore session, the console prompts for the team recovery passphrase, which is recorded immediately below for reference.

unlock words, hahip-baduf: holwyn-istath-julvan